<idAbs>This service is a collection of spatial data layers representing Version 1.0 of the New Zealand (NZ) Landslide Dam Database (NZLDD) that has been developed by GNS Science and contains recent, historic and prehistoric landslide dams in NZ, defined as significant, ephemeral or enduring blockages of a watercourse by a landslide. Note that Debris Trail and Dam, as mapped here, together comprise the landslide deposit, with the Dam limited to the part of the deposit damming its respective watercourse, i.e., the deposit that lies within the valley bottom. Version 1.0 contains many catalogued landslide dams, but is not a complete database of all landslide dams that have ever occurred in NZ. The database together with a full description of the data has been published by Morgenstern et al. (2023) (accessed from https://doi.org/10.1007/s10346-023-02133-4) and can be downloaded as an ArcGIS geodatabase from https://doi.org/10.17605/OSF.IO/NW6MT. Visit https://doi.org/10.21420/47GZ-A116 for full description of New Zealand Landslide Dam Database Version 1.0.</idAbs>
